Fecal screening of Dientamoeba fragilis: relative efficacy of permanent smear and culture
In conclusion, culture had a high performance compared to microscopy in the diagnosis ofD. fragilis infection. Culture can be applied for routine diagnosis for the detection ofD. fragilis in clinical samples.
